Job description

Contract Type: Permanent

The Opportunity

An experienced Audit Senior is required by a well-established and growing accountancy practice based in Kildare.

The firm has an excellent reputation, a loyal and varied client base and an experienced team of accounting, audit and tax professionals. The practice works with a broad range of high-quality SME clients across multiple sectors and offers a friendly, supportive working environment with exceptionally low staff turnover.

The role will have an approximately 80% audit focus, with the balance involving accounts preparation and related client work. It would suit a qualified auditor with two to three years’ post-qualification experience who is looking for greater responsibility, strong client exposure and continued career progression.

Key Responsibilities
  • Managing statutory audits from planning through to completion
  • Preparing audit files for manager and partner review
  • Identifying audit risks and ensuring assignments are completed within agreed budgets and timelines
  • Supervising junior team members and reviewing their work
  • Acting as a key point of contact for clients throughout the audit process
  • Preparing statutory financial statements and assisting with accounts assignments as required
Candidate Profile

The successful candidate will:

  • Be ACA, ACCA or CPA qualified
  • Have approximately two to three years’ post-qualification experience
  • Have strong audit experience gained within an accountancy practice
  • Be comfortable managing audits from planning through to completion
  • Possess strong technical accounting and auditing knowledge
  • Be confident dealing directly with clients and supervising junior staff
  • Demonstrate strong organisational and communication skills
The Package
  • Solid bonus scheme which has historically always been paid
  • 23 days’ annual leave
  • Flexible and hybrid working arrangements
  • Professional subscriptions and continued professional development support
  • Genuine opportunities for continued career progression
  • Supportive working environment with excellent work-life balance
